Diego Andres Rodriguez to join Rachel Zegler in Jamie Lloyd’s production of EVITA

Photo credit: Sam Pickart

It has been announced that Diego Andres Rodriguez will star as Che, alongside the previously announced Rachel Zegler as Eva Perón, in Tim Rice and Andrew Lloyd Webber’s Evita, which runs at the London Palladium from 14 June-6 September.

Director Jamie Lloyd said: “Before he even graduated, Diego made his professional debut as Artie in our production of Sunset Blvd. on Broadway, in which he also understudied and played the leading role, Joe Gillis. He is an incredible young actor and a fantastic vocalist. We’re so thrilled he will be making his West End debut in Tim and Andrew’s iconic musical.”

Diego Andres Rodriguez said: “I’m beyond thrilled to be making my West End debut in Evita this summer at the historic London Palladium! Being directed by Jamie Lloyd again, working with The Jamie Lloyd Company’s incredible team, and playing Che opposite Rachel is an opportunity of a lifetime. This is a dream come true!”

Full cast and creatives are to be announced.
